1) ios5 devices no longer need to be synced with a computer, though they can be. You can't sync your iphone to your iPad, but you can treat each independently.
2) I've never had a problem with my bank's site. Adobe themselves have abandoned Flash for mobile devices, so in time this issue will become less and less significant. In fact even now it's rarely an issue.
3) MS office doesn't run on iPad, but Apples iworks suite does. You can open MS office files and even export them back into MS Office formats. In truth it's so simple and straightforward that you quickly forget that they're entirely separate formats. There is also the option of 3rd party Apps, Freeware, that can handle MS Office files.
4) I found the key is not to expect the iPad to be a laptop with a few differences. It's an entirely separate product needing entirely different inputs. If your use is as you describe, mostly web-based, email etc, then iPad suits perfectly. Where it doesn't suit so well is where lots of keyboard input is required. Good though the ios software keyboards are, they are not the same thing as a physical keyboard. Fedback is entirely different etc.  For that reason, iPad would not be ideally suited if there is lots of that type of input required.

    You can use the camera connection kit to copy photos to the iPad's Photos app, and it supports SDXC cards - this page says :
    SDXC (supported only when not formatted as ExFAT)
    As long as the card has a DCIM directory off its root with the photos and videos underneath it with filenames exactly 8 characters long (no spaces) plus extension then they should be recognised and be able to be copied to the Photos app. Photos and videos that are imported via the kit can be deleted directly in the iPad's Photos app
